BP reaches $18.7 billion settlement over deadly 2010 spill

HOUSTON (Reuters) – BP Plc will pay up to $18.7 billion in penalties to the U.S. government and five states to resolve nearly all claims from its deadly Gulf of Mexico oil spill five years ago in the largest corporate settlement in U.S. history.

Oklahoma county commissioner arrested on gun and drug charges

OKLAHOMA CITY (Reuters) – A county commissioner in rural Oklahoma and his wife have been arrested on suspicion of the illegal possession of a firearm and drugs, the Oklahoma State Board of Investigation said on Thursday.

Two San Francisco TV news crews attacked during live broadcast

SAN FRANCISCO (Reuters) – Two San Francisco television news crews were attacked and robbed and a camera operator pistol-whipped while reporting on a homicide early on Thursday, in an incident that was partly captured on live TV, local media reported.

Mattress maker Serta next in line to dump Trump

(Reuters) – U.S. mattress maker Serta said it would not renew its licensing agreement with the Trump Organization, the latest company to distance itself from real estate developer and TV personality Donald Trump, after his comments insulting Mexicans.

Tornado hits outside Kansas City, Missouri, damaging buildings

(Reuters) – A tornado hit Lee’s Summit, Missouri, outside Kansas City on Wednesday evening, causing damage to several buildings and overturning a fireworks trailer, the city’s fire department said.
